Transaction 95d99c56f338cf7cabf2040f13f938b25be2f8a5da255923f5f69441787bf6b2

block
f782afd79be6fb153b0d6922e23c2a9450bfe46bf6c1348e486e19e7c8ad32f8

60 Inputs

1 Output